Rock Creek Trail opens in Independence

The first phase of Independence’s Rock Creek Trail is now open in the western part of the city.  The first 1.5 mile segment runs from Rotary Park near 23rd and Northern to Country Club Park near 30th and Norton. It’s … Continue reading

Platte Countians renew parks/rec tax, including trails

Platte County voters recently renewed a 1/2-cent sales tax for parks and recreation.  Over the next ten years the tax is expected to fund about 30 miles of new trail construction.  Some key trails projects include extending the Missouri River … Continue reading
